Algeria Leader Wants Death Penalty For Bad Fires

Published September 2, 2026 · By globe newsreport

Bad forest fires recently hit many parts of Algeria. The fires burned many trees and green plants. Big black smoke filled the bright blue sky. People felt scared when the flames grew. Firefighters ran fast to stop the hot fires.

Many people lost their homes in the fires. Animals had to run away from the danger. The weather was very hot and dry. Dry grass helps fires burn very fast. The government watched the fires all day long.

Leader Wants New Rule

The leader of Algeria spoke about the fires. His name is President Abdelmadjid Tebboune. He wants a very tough new rule. People who start fires must face the death penalty. This punishment is very severe for bad criminals.

The leader thinks some fires were no accident. Bad people might start fires on purpose. The police must check these bad acts. Arson means someone sets fires on purpose. The leader wants to stop this bad crime.
